Plain-language summary
This study intends to compare the effects of Static stretching Protocols with Dynamic stretching protocols on racquet sports players to find out how these protocols affect their performance.

Inclusion Criteria:
* Males.
* Age 20- 40 years.
* Amateur Active players with at least 1 year of regular experience.
* Free from any musculoskeletal injuries or conditions affecting participation.
* Willing to provide written informed consent.
Exclusion Criteria:
* Players with ongoing or recent (\<3 months) musculoskeletal injuries.
* Those with chronic conditions (e.g., arthritis, cardiovascular issues) affecting physical activity.
* Those suffering with any medical condition that affects their performance.
* Participants who are currently following a specialized stretching regimen outside regular squash warm-ups.
* Use of medications that could affect muscle function or perception during the Study.
